So, what are beach reads? To put it simply, beach reads are a popular subgenre within fiction, which are especially written and published for the summer season. These types of books always entail a story that is set someplace beachy, frequently revolve around a romance and have an enjoyable, light-hearted feel. A lot of the best holiday reads of all time are within the beach read classification, mainly due to the fact that they are quick, entertaining and straightforward to read. Beach reads have a feel-good vibe to them and they always have in a happy ending, which is why they are the ideal genre for people who merely want to have a good time on their holidays.
